APS Kaluchak organises online debate competition
7/8/2020 12:25:37 AM
Early Times Report

Jammu, July 7: ‘Aao Debate Karen’ an online Debate Competition was organised by Master Prabhnoor Singh, a student of class XI of APS Kaluchak for the students of classes VIII to XII on 03 July 2020.
The event was planned in order to enable the students get rid of the stultifying effects of the present situation which had in turn taken toll on their efficiency and caliber. It was instrumental in breaking the flourishing abominable monotony which retreated with the advent of the event and the insipidity vanished in thin air thereby enriching the participants.
The students were bequeathed with the platform to give vent to their opinions on various social, economical, environmental and cultural topics which was an extension of their innate potential. This was an online and on the spot debate competition in a knock out format. A total of sixteen teams (32 debaters) took part in this competition from different schools of Jammu and various other cities.
With no stage fright to bother otherwise reticent students, many took initiative to explore various aspects of the topics given to them. Ms Vianca and Ms Prableen Kour of APS Kaluchak expressed themselves in an exemplary fashion and their team namely Fire Breathing Rubber Duckies clinched the winners title .
The Runner up team namely Kamikazes comprised of Master Sarvpratham Singh of Springdale Senior School Amritsar and Master Siddarth of APS Kaluchak
Master Siddarth, Ms Prableen Kour and Ms Sachita S were adjudged as the top three debaters. They sieved the information from their individual experiences and put forth very apt and relevant examples which were purely correlated with the real life endeavours.
The eloquent participants were appreciated and the winners were accoladed by the Special Guests Hem Lata Vishen, Principal APS Kaluchak ; Rouble Nagi, a prominent social activist and Bhavdeep Ahluwalia, Founder of the organization called LIONISE.
